Career path

Career Role Description
Palliative Care Chaplain (Cancer & Faith) Provides spiritual and emotional support to cancer patients and their families, integrating faith-based perspectives into palliative care. High demand in hospices and healthcare settings.
Cancer Support Group Facilitator (Faith-Based) Leads and facilitates support groups for individuals and families affected by cancer, utilizing faith-based principles to foster resilience and coping mechanisms. Growing demand in community settings and faith-based organizations.
Bereavement Counselor (Cancer Focus) Specializes in providing grief counseling and support to individuals experiencing loss due to cancer, integrating faith-based approaches where appropriate. Increasing demand in hospices, hospitals, and private practices.
Spiritual Care Coordinator (Oncology) Coordinates spiritual care services within an oncology setting, collaborating with healthcare professionals and faith leaders to meet the spiritual needs of patients. Demand increasing in larger hospitals and healthcare systems.
